Encyclopedia > Bruce Hunter

Bruce Hunter (born 1952) is a Canadian poet. 1952 (MCMLII) was a Leap year starting on Tuesday (link will take you to calendar). ... The poor poet A poet is a person who writes poetry. ...


Born in Calgary, Alberta, he studied film at York University. Calgary is a city in the province of Alberta, Canada. ... Bibliography

  • Benchmark (1982)
  • The Beekeeper's Daughter (1986)
  • Country Music Country (1996)
  • Coming Home From Home (2000)

Staff Bio - Bruce Hunter (138 words)
Bruce Hunter directs the legislative efforts of the American Association of School Administrators in Congress and the U.S. Department of Education.
Hunter came to AASA in 1982 as a Legislative Specialist.
Hunter received a Bachelor of Arts from the University of Northern Colorado, a Master of Arts from the University of Texas at El Paso and did graduate work in education administration at the University of Colorado.
